Estate Planning for a Mobile Population

Contemplating moving to another state or have a client considering an interstate move, or even another country? In today's mobile society, an increasing number of people find themselves relocating, yet many do not consult their estate planning attorney to consider the impact the laws of their new domicile state may have on existing estate plans.

Careful attention must be paid to the laws of the new and former domiciles in formulating an appropriate estate plan. This OnDemand Webinar will emphasize the different estate planning issues that should be considered when planning an interstate move.

Agenda

Property Rights

  • Community Property vs. Common Law Jurisdictions
  • Spousal Rights and Elections
  • Homestead Laws
  • Joint Tenancy, Tenants by the Entirety and Tenants in Common
  • Pre- and Post-Nuptial Agreements
  • Ancillary Documents

Intestacy vs. Testacy

  • Validity of Will
  • Fiduciary Selection

Probate Process

  • Probate Variations
  • Use of Living Trusts
  • Use of Entities to Avoid Probate

Trust Residence

  • Estate, Inheritance and Income Tax Issues
  • Trustee Selection
  • Trust Situs
  • Asset Protection
  • Rule Against Perpetuities
  • Decanting vs. Merger vs. Division

Foreign Estate Planning

  • In-Bound
    • Use of OffShore Trusts and Companies
    • Gifts Before Establishing Residency
    • Local Origin, Law
    • Definition of Domiciliary
    • U.S. Tax on Resident vs. NonResident
  • Out-Bound
    • Expatriation Law
    • Laws of Other Countries
